Locke and Key Season 3 Release Date
The final season of the fantasy television series will debut on August 10, 2022, as planned. Less than a year after the second season's release, the third is already available.
The Locke & Key crew was able to do this because they started filming the third season before the second had even debuted and because a significant amount of the third season's script was written while Season 2 was being filmed. Since the seasons were shot so closely together, there won't be much of a time jump in the narrative, picking up right after the disastrous events of Season 2.
The Locke & Key Season 3 trailer, which debuted on June 6, 2022, on the official Netflix YouTube channel, gives viewers a preview of the upcoming conflicts with several demons from various eras and the appearance of the family's worst enemy. According to radiotimes, Locke and Key Season 3 is set to premiere on August 10.

Locke and Key Season 3 Cast
As the titular Locke family, it has been revealed that Jackson Robert Scott (It), Emilia Jones (Coda), Aaron Ashmore (Veronica Mars), and Darby Stanchfield (Scandal) will all return. Additionally, Laysla De Oliveira (In The Tall Grass) will make a comeback as the demonic Dodge, and Kevin Durand (Legion) will continue to play the menacing Captain Gideon.
Scot has left to pursue a career in film in England, so it's unclear if actor Petrice Jones (Step Up: High Water) will return. However, Ellie, who has just been rescued, is portrayed by Sherri Saum (Sunset Beach), and Rufus, her son, is portrayed by Coby Bird (The Good Doctor), both of whom have been confirmed as returning cast members with even bigger roles in the upcoming season.
Griffin Gluck (American Vandal), who played the enigmatic and cunning Gabe in the previous two seasons, is one of the cast members who is a fan favorite but has not been officially confirmed to return. We don't know if this version of the character will return in Season 3 because his body is missing during the crucial cliffside battle and because his true identity was exposed. Although the actress Hallea Jones (Let It Snow) hasn't been confirmed, it's likely that she will return because her character is stuck at the bottom of the well.

Locke and Key Season 3 Plot
There is a lot of anticipation for the last season of the show because the action was amplified in the second season. And based on the Season 3 trailer, viewers can expect an action-packed finale with a number of villains and plenty of story twists that are inspired by comic books.
Both physically and symbolically, Locke and Key Season 2 came to an abrupt end. The adolescent demon possessor Gabe's body was never discovered, and when his opulent new mansion fell down a cliff, everyone assumed he had died. But the Locke family should know better than to think that a single horrific incident could stop Dodge from carrying out her evil scheme when it comes to demons.
In the upcoming episode, there are more villains than Dodge causing havoc, however, some of them are utterly stuck. After lifting the echo of the possessed Captain Gideon from the well, Eden was herself flung carelessly into the pitch-black abyss.
Her character will undoubtedly return, but there are whispers that Eden may flip sides and seek vengeance with the Locke family after being tricked and used by the demons she had previously sought to help.
Most of the keys, which were given to the Locke family by Lucas' echo when he emerged unhurt from the debris at the site of the demolished cliffside mansion, are now in their control.
Bode informed his mother about the status of the demons her children have been combating using the keys. Since his key killed both the demon possessing Jackie and the body it was inhabiting, Tyler has made the decision to take some time off as he deals with his loss of her.
He still feels responsible for her death. You cannot escape your past, a voice in the Season 3 teaser declares, giving away Tyler's upcoming appearance.
